Karen Sue Wayne, 71

Posted

Karen Sue Wayne, 71, of Hillsboro, formerly of Morrisonville, died on Saturday, April 4, 2020, at 12:08 a.m. at Hillsboro Area Hospital.

Private family ceremonies will be held with the Rev. Dayle Badman officiating. Interment will follow the ceremonies at Elm Lawn Memorial Park in Litchfield. Perfetti-Assalley Funeral Home of Morrisonville is assisting the family.

Ms. Wayne was born Nov. 19, 1948, in Litchfield, to Melvin and Shirley (Jones) Wempen, Sr. She married Perry Wayne of Fillmore, and they later divorced.

She graduated from Morrisonville High School with the class of 1966, and went on to earn her beautician’s license from the Taylorville School of Cosmetology.

Ms. Wayne owned and operated salons in Morrisonville, Taylorville, Hillsboro and Irving. Later in life, she worked for Alco and eventually retired from Addus HealthCare.

She was a past member of the United Methodist Church of Morrisonville, and enjoyed doing a variety of craft projects and flower arranging.

Ms. Wayne is survived by her parents of Morrisonville; brothers, Melvin (wife MaDonna) Wempen, Jr. of Raymond and Kurt (wife Janet) Wempen of Morrisonville; sister, Connie (husband Jim) Young of New Windsor; eight nieces; one nephew; and several cousins.
